What’s NGS All About?

So, what exactly is NGS, and why should you know about it? The National Geodetic Survey is the powerhouse behind the accurate measurements and coordinates that form the backbone of the National Spatial Reference System (NSRS). Picture this system as a magical tapestry weaving together points and values that define the locations across the U.S.—from bustling cities to remote mountain ranges. It provides that much-needed consistency for professionals in surveying, engineering, and environmental studies.

Think of it this way: If GPS is your trusty guide to finding the best taco truck in a new city, NGS is the architect, ensuring those taco trucks are accurately placed on the map. It’s all about providing accurate positioning for various applications—mapping, infrastructure development, and those nuanced environmental assessments that allow us to make informed decisions about our land and resources.

The Heart of Accurate Land Measurement

At the core of NGS’s mission are geodetic control points. You’ve probably seen surveyors tapping away with their tools, right? These control points are their lifelines because they denote specific locations on the Earth's surface that have been meticulously measured. Surveyors use these points to achieve precise land measurements. Whether they’re laying out a new residential development or measuring the footprint of your favorite park, these control points provide the accuracy and reliability that’s vital for planning and execution.

Other Key Players in the Game

Now, it’s crucial to acknowledge the hard work of other entities that contribute to the surveying and geographic landscape, even if they focus on different aspects:

  • National Society of Professional Surveyors (NSPS): This group champions the interests of surveying professionals. They’re the voice of the surveying industry, advocating for better practices and seamless regulations.

  • United States Geological Survey (USGS): While this agency primarily focuses on natural resources and mitigation of geological hazards, they’re also a treasure trove of geological information that helps painting a comprehensive picture of the environment.

  • National Bureau of Standards (NBS): Although this has transformed into the National Institute of Standards and Technology (NIST), they’ve historically been pivotal in developing measurement standards, albeit without a direct focus on geographic coordinates. They’re more like the behind-the-scenes crew ensuring that everything functions on a quantitative level.
